Centralizing Information for Streamlined Team Workflows
Centralization of information is vital for any organization aiming for efficiency. Knowledge management software becomes the cornerstone in achieving streamlined workflows. By having a single source of truth, teams minimize confusion and discrepancies in data handling.
This consolidation also simplifies the process of maintaining and updating organizational knowledge. It becomes easier to manage versions and control the quality of information that is disseminated across the team. Consequently, everyone works with the latest, most accurate data.
In addition, centralization aids in the protection of sensitive data. Knowledge management systems often include robust access controls and security measures to ensure that only authorized personnel can access certain information, thereby maintaining confidentiality and compliance.
Knowledge Management Software: Bridging the Gap Between Remote Teams
In the age of remote work, knowledge management software is more important than ever. Remote teams face unique challenges in collaboration, often due to physical separation and different time zones. Knowledge management platforms help bridge these gaps by enabling asynchronous collaboration.
With these platforms, remote workers can access the collective intelligence of their organization at any hour, fostering a sense of inclusion and equality. They no longer need to wait for responses from colleagues in different regions, which can accelerate project timelines and reduce delays.
Furthermore, these systems can play a critical role in building company culture among remote teams. They facilitate a shared space for storing not just work-related documents but also team achievements, success stories, and best practices, helping to maintain a sense of community and shared purpose.
Measuring the Impact of Knowledge Management on Team Productivity

As teams integrate knowledge management systems into their workflows, it’s essential to measure the impact on productivity. Metrics such as time spent on searching for information, completion rates for tasks, and the number of resolved inquiries can all indicate the effectiveness of knowledge management integration.
Moreover, observing patterns in collaboration can provide insights into how well team members are utilizing the platform. These measures can help identify areas for improvement or further training needs.
Another significant indicator is employee satisfaction. When team members can access and contribute to a shared knowledge base, they often feel more empowered and engaged, which can lead to higher job satisfaction and reduced turnover rates.
